Types of Tooth Extraction

Simple Extractions

Simple extractions are performed on teeth that are visible in the mouth. These procedures are typically quick and involve minimal discomfort. Our skilled dentists use gentle techniques to ensure a smooth process.

Surgical Extractions

Surgical extractions are necessary for teeth that are not easily accessible, such as impacted wisdom teeth or teeth broken below the gum line. At Shine Family Dental Surgery, we employ advanced methods to minimise discomfort and promote faster healing.

When You Need a Tooth Extraction

Tooth extraction might be necessary if you experience any of the following symptoms:

  • Severe dental decay
  • Impacted wisdom teeth causing pain or infection
  • Overcrowding that affects your bite or orthodontic treatment
  • Oral infections that do not respond to other treatments

Recovery & Aftercare

Our care doesn’t end with the procedure; we will provide you with personalised after-care instructions, and we will follow up with you to ensure you are healing well. Here are some general aftercare tips for you to be aware of:

  • Manage pain with prescribed medications.
  • Follow a soft food diet while avoiding hot drinks for the first 24 hours.
  • Keep the extraction site clean, but avoid vigorous rinsing for 24 hours.
  • Contact us if you experience excessive bleeding or severe pain.

Most patients experience a recovery period of about one week, during which they can typically resume their normal daily activities. However, it’s important to note that complete tissue healing and full restoration of function can take a little longer. This time varies from person to person, depending on the complexity of the extraction and adherence to post-operative care instructions.

Factors such as age, overall health, immune system efficiency, and the presence of any pre-existing conditions can all influence the precise duration required for a full recovery.

Following a tooth extraction, a carefully managed diet is crucial for promoting healing, minimising discomfort, and preventing complications. Stick to soft foods like yoghurt and mashed potatoes initially, gradually reintroducing solid foods as healing progresses.

While some discomfort and minor bleeding are normal after a tooth extraction, we urge you to contact us immediately if you experience any unusual symptoms that go beyond normal expectations. Specifically, please reach out to us if you notice:

  • Persistent or heavy bleeding: If bleeding continues for an extended period, significantly beyond what was explained as normal, or if it’s profuse and difficult to control, please call us.
  • Severe or worsening pain: While some pain is to be expected, if you experience intense pain that isn’t managed by prescribed or over-the-counter pain medication, or if your pain significantly worsens over time, this is a cause for concern.
  • Swelling that increases or spreads: Minor swelling is common, but if the swelling becomes excessive, is accompanied by difficulty swallowing or breathing, or spreads rapidly, it requires immediate attention.
  • Fever or chills: These symptoms could indicate an infection and should be reported to us right away.
    Numbness that persists beyond the expected duration: If an area remains numb long after the local anesthetic should have worn off, please contact us.
  • Any allergic reactions: If you experience hives, rash, itching, or difficulty breathing, seek immediate medical attention and inform us as soon as possible.
